Why does tuberculosis have white phlegm in the throat

White phlegm in the throat in people with tuberculosis may be associated with an exacerbation. It can also be caused by drug side effects, bacterial infections, etc.

1. Reasons

1. Aggravation of the disease: When the condition of tuberculosis patients gradually worsens, it will lead to irritation of the respiratory tract, which will cause the symptoms of coughing, and will also be accompanied by the phenomenon of coughing up white foamy sputum;

2. Drug side effects: If you take anti-tuberculosis drugs during treatment, such as rifampicin capsules, etc., it may cause certain irritation to the gastrointestinal tract, and then produce nausea, vomiting and other symptoms, and some people will show white phlegm in the throat;

3. Bacterial infection: If tuberculosis patients do not pay attention to personal hygiene, or the body's immunity is low, it is easy to develop secondary bacterial infection, which can make the throat mucosa congested and edematous, and the secretion will increase, so there will be white phlegm in the throat.
